Separate series has been sent for the inta irqchip driver: https://lore.kernel.org/lkml/20200928063930.12012-1-peter.ujfalusi@ti.com/ Patches for the DMA support will be based on this series due to build and feature dependencies. To support the new DMSS we need to change the ti_sci ring config API in order to be able to support the new parameters needed in the future. We also need to add support for the second range in RM as along with the AM64 support, the resource allocation is going to change for existing SoC which used only the first range for resource allocation. The tx_tdtype support has been also missing from ti_sci for a long time and the AM64 specific extended_ch_type depends on the existence of it in the message struct.
